    And they are right this time. Paypal doesn,t charge when the payment is a gift. Many people transfer as a gift to avoid paying the 4% charge. That is a risk when the supplier doesn,t deliver.     One thing you all want to watch here is PayPal don't get the arse with those that sent money as a gift
    For goods , they may well see it as you went out of your way not to pay thier fees, and freeze you account,or even bar you from having a PayPal account.
